> On the latest series of ThinkPads, the button events for the TrackPoint
> are reported through the touchpad itself as opposed to the TrackPoint
> device. In order to report these buttons properly, we need to forward
> them to the TrackPoint device and notify psmouse to send the button
> presses/releases.

Hi Dmitry,

thanks for the follow up on this series.

I had to add the following hunk to this patch for the buttons to
actually be forwarded:

diff --git a/drivers/input/rmi4/rmi_f30.c b/drivers/input/rmi4/rmi_f30.c
index 938d31e..3422464 100644
--- a/drivers/input/rmi4/rmi_f30.c
+++ b/drivers/input/rmi4/rmi_f30.c
@@ -151,10 +151,13 @@ static int rmi_f30_attention(struct rmi_function *fn, 
unsigned long *irq_bits)
                }
        }
 
-       if (f30->has_gpio)
+       if (f30->has_gpio) {
                for (i = 0; i < f30->gpioled_count; i++)
                        if (f30->gpioled_key_map[i] != KEY_RESERVED)
                                rmi_f30_report_button(fn, f30, i);
+               if (f30->trackstick_buttons)
+                       rmi_f03_commit_buttons(f30->f03);
+       }
 
        return 0;
 }
---

With this hunk added, I tested the series with the synaptics PS/2 path
and SMBus on a t450s, and the i2c-hid path on a development touchpad.
All seem to behave well:

Tested-By: Benjamin Tissoires <benjamin.tissoi...@redhat.com>
